Output a0586623420c3bf5efbdf362fcf2861b5a31bc78c3e4e8c19aeca96236f6efa5:0

value
849297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0b0ab1d11e0edb3e219d33812e0e75fb0df3044 OP_EQUAL
address
3NB4vefhuWRgjfxVE1JLtbMjZStRWKYJAq
transaction
a0586623420c3bf5efbdf362fcf2861b5a31bc78c3e4e8c19aeca96236f6efa5
spent
true